Nick Woltemade is expected to make his World Cup debut when Germany face Ecuador in their final Group E match on Thursday, Bild reports, with Deniz Undav set to start as a No 10.

The 24-year-old Newcastle United forward has yet to feature at the tournament, a situation that now looks likely to change.

It remains unclear whether he will replace Kai Havertz up front or come off the bench.

Before the 2-1 win over Côte d’Ivoire, Woltemade said he was “working hard” for his chance. That match did not bring his first minutes.

Julian Nagelsmann’s side are already certain to finish top of Group E.
